在当今信息技术高速发展的时代,GitHub作为一个广泛使用的开源项目托管平台,已经成为全球开发者的重要工具。然而,伴随而来的是网络内容的安全问题,尤其是在扫黄打非的背景下,GitHub如何发挥作用变得尤为重要。本文将从多个角度探讨GitHub在扫黄打非工作中的作用以及其对开发者社区的影响。
一、什么是扫黄打非
扫黄打非是指针对色情、暴力等违法不良信息进行的清理和打击活动。此活动旨在维护网络环境的健康和安全,保护公众尤其是未成年人免受不良信息的影响。
1.1 扫黄打非的背景
在信息化时代,互联网内容的多样性和丰富性也带来了不少问题:
- 不良信息传播迅速
- 网络诈骗、色情内容层出不穷
- 影响社会风气,危害未成年人
1.2 扫黄打非的意义
扫黄打非的实施,意义重大:
- 保护社会道德
- 维护网络安全
- 创建良好的互联网环境
二、GitHub的基本介绍
GitHub是一个基于Git的版本控制工具,主要用于托管和管理代码,已经成为全球最大的开源社区之一。其功能包括:
- 代码托管
- 版本控制
- 代码评审
2.1 GitHub的用户群体
GitHub拥有全球范围的开发者和团队,包括:
- 开源项目维护者
- 软件开发者
- 数据科学家
2.2 GitHub的影响力
GitHub不仅是代码托管平台,还是技术分享和知识传播的社区。其影响力逐渐扩展到:
- 教育领域
- 企业开发
- 社会公益
三、GitHub在扫黄打非中的作用
3.1 代码审核机制
GitHub提供的代码审核机制,可以有效地减少恶意代码的上传。
- 提供社区反馈
- 引入多级审核流程
3.2 社区自我管理
GitHub的开发者社区具有自我管理的能力,通过设定社区规则,抵制不良内容的传播。
- 设定行为规范
- 鼓励举报机制
3.3 API监控与数据分析
GitHub开放的API允许进行数据监控与分析,从而有效识别和打击违法内容。
- 实时监控
- 数据分析工具
四、实践案例
在GitHub上,已有多个项目积极参与扫黄打非活动,以下是一些实践案例:
4.1 项目A:代码内容审核工具
该项目专注于开发一款代码内容审核工具,能够自动检测并标记含有敏感词汇的代码。
4.2 项目B:社区反馈平台
通过设立反馈平台,鼓励用户对不良内容进行举报,有效维护社区环境。
五、面临的挑战
尽管GitHub在扫黄打非方面做出了努力,但仍面临诸多挑战:
- 用户数量庞大,审核成本高
- 文化差异导致标准不一
- 技术更新迅速,监管滞后
六、未来的发展方向
为了更好地应对扫黄打非的挑战,GitHub可以采取以下措施:
- 加强社区规则的执行
- 提升技术监测手段
- 加强与政府和组织的合作
七、常见问答
7.1 GitHub上如何举报不良内容?
用户可以通过GitHub的举报功能,报告任何可疑的项目或内容。具体步骤包括:
- 点击项目页面的“举报”按钮
- 提供详细信息和截图
7.2 GitHub如何处理举报?
GitHub收到举报后,会进行审核,若确认内容违规,将采取下列措施:
- 删除违规内容
- 对违规用户进行封禁
7.3 扫黄打非的政策如何影响GitHub?
扫黄打非政策的实施,促使GitHub加强内容审核,提高平台的安全性,从而为开发者创造一个更健康的社区环境。
7.4 开发者在GitHub上如何参与扫黄打非?
开发者可以通过以下方式参与扫黄打非活动:
- 积极举报不良内容
- 参与或发起相关的开源项目
- 提供教育资源,提高公众的意识
八、结论
在信息技术飞速发展的今天,GitHub在扫黄打非工作中扮演着重要角色。通过社区自我管理、代码审核机制和数据分析,GitHub为维护网络安全和社会道德贡献力量。未来,随着技术的不断进步,GitHub将在扫黄打非方面继续发挥积极作用。